Seasonal closures or maintenance schedules at the course

Pelican Hill Golf Course, renowned for its oceanfront views and pristine conditions, operates on a meticulous maintenance schedule to uphold its world-class standards. Seasonal closures and maintenance periods are strategically planned to coincide with weather patterns and turfgrass health requirements, ensuring the course remains in peak condition year-round. These closures are not arbitrary but are rooted in agronomic science and environmental considerations. For instance, overseeding—a process where cool-season grasses are introduced to enhance winter playability—typically occurs in late fall, necessitating temporary course closures or reduced availability. Understanding these schedules helps golfers plan their visits effectively while appreciating the effort behind the course’s excellence.

One of the most critical maintenance periods at Pelican Hill is the overseeding season, usually taking place in October or November. During this time, the course may close for several weeks to allow the new grass to establish. While this might inconvenience golfers in the short term, the result is a lush, green playing surface throughout the cooler months. Golfers should note that not all holes or courses (Pelican Hill has two: the North and South Courses) may close simultaneously, offering partial play options. Proactive planning, such as booking tee times well in advance or inquiring about maintenance schedules, can mitigate disruptions and ensure a seamless experience.

Beyond overseeding, Pelican Hill also conducts routine aeration and verticutting to manage soil compaction and promote healthy turf growth. These procedures, often scheduled during slower months like late spring or early summer, may lead to temporary course closures or modified play conditions. While aeration holes or freshly cut turf might initially affect play, these practices are essential for long-term course health. Golfers can turn this to their advantage by using these periods to focus on short-game practice or exploring other amenities at the resort. Staying informed about these schedules through the course’s website or newsletters can transform potential inconveniences into opportunities.

Comparatively, Pelican Hill’s maintenance approach differs from many inland courses, which often face fewer weather-related challenges. Its coastal location exposes it to salt spray, high winds, and temperature fluctuations, requiring a more rigorous care regimen. For example, the course employs specialized irrigation systems and soil amendments to combat salinity and maintain optimal moisture levels. These efforts underscore the importance of seasonal closures, as they allow the grounds crew to address unique environmental stressors without compromising play quality. Golfers who frequent coastal courses like Pelican Hill should expect and embrace these schedules as part of the experience.

Tee time availability and booking procedures

Pelican Hill Golf Course, nestled in the heart of Newport Coast, California, is renowned for its stunning ocean views and meticulously designed courses. If you’re planning a visit, understanding tee time availability and booking procedures is crucial to securing your spot on this prestigious course. Here’s a detailed guide to help you navigate the process seamlessly.

Analyzing Tee Time Availability:

Tee times at Pelican Hill are highly sought after, especially during peak seasons (spring and fall) and weekends. The course offers two championship layouts—the North and South Courses—each with its own unique challenges and scenic beauty. Availability tends to fluctuate based on factors like weather, holidays, and special events. For instance, mornings fill up faster due to the cooler temperatures and optimal playing conditions. To increase your chances of securing a preferred slot, consider booking during off-peak hours (late afternoons) or on weekdays. Additionally, checking availability 30–60 days in advance is recommended, as tee times open up two months ahead.

Step-by-Step Booking Procedures:

Booking a tee time at Pelican Hill is straightforward but requires prompt action. Start by visiting the official website or using the resort’s mobile app, where you can view real-time availability. Guests staying at the Pelican Hill Resort often receive priority booking, so consider bundling your stay with a golf package for added convenience. For non-guests, tee times can be reserved online or by calling the golf pro shop directly. Payment is typically required at the time of booking, and cancellation policies vary, so review the terms carefully. Pro tip: Sign up for the course’s newsletter or follow their social media channels for updates on last-minute openings or special promotions.

Comparing Booking Options:

While online booking is the most convenient method, calling the pro shop offers a personalized experience. Staff members can provide insights on course conditions, recommend the best times based on your skill level, and assist with special requests like club rentals or caddie services. Third-party booking platforms may also list tee times, but they often come with additional fees and limited flexibility. For the best value and control, stick to the official channels. If you’re part of a large group or planning a corporate event, inquire about group booking options, which may include discounted rates and exclusive access to amenities.

Practical Tips for a Smooth Experience:

To avoid disappointment, set a reminder for when tee times open up for your desired date. Early birds often catch the best slots, especially for weekend play. If your schedule is flexible, consider booking a twilight tee time, which offers reduced rates and a more relaxed pace. For first-time visitors, arrive at least 30 minutes before your tee time to familiarize yourself with the facilities, including the driving range and putting green. Lastly, dress code enforcement is strict, so ensure you adhere to the guidelines to avoid any delays or issues.
